Fourteen of the restaurants that participated in the original 1992 event are a part of this years lineup Barbetta, Carmines, Docks Oyster Bar, Gage & Tollner, Gallaghers Steak House, The Palm, Sardis, Shun Lee West, Sylvias, Tavern on the Green, Tribeca Grill, The Russian Tea Room, Union Square Caf, and Victors Caf. Built in a 1906 carriage house, Barbetta still retains the design and look of the early to mid 1900s, as well as being owned by the same family for more than a century. NYC & Company,the citys tourism agency, last week announced reservations are now open at 600 participating restaurants across 85 neighborhoods. Throughout the course of Restaurant Week, diners can pick from a selection of$30, $45, and $60 two-course lunches and $30, $45, and $60 three-course dinners.
